God Sees You

Many times, we go through difficult situations and can be tempted to believe that we are alone in our struggles.  When we pray and we don't feel like God is answering us in the way or in the time we thought He might, it is easy to believe He is not listening.  When we expect others to rally around us, and we look around and see no one there in that moment, we can feel like we are walking this road alone. When our faith gives way to doubt, fear, or confusion, we often feel a sense of shame as if we are not a good enough Christian. I want you to know that your Father sees you. In your struggle, He sees you. In your loneliness, He sees you. In your doubt or fear or confusion, He sees you. When you get angry, He sees you. More than that, though. He is with you. He will not abandon you. When others are not there, He still is. The Holy Spirit is within you and there to comfort you and give you peace. Your questions do not offend Him, nor will they cause Him to forsake you. He loves you and accepts you, questions, doubts, fears, and all. Talk to Him about them. He already knows. You will not shock Him. In the midst of hurt, disappointment, loss, and confusion, your Father is there to reassure you that this temporary situation will not have the final word. He will. He will somehow bring good into even the worst circumstances. He who turned the death of Jesus into the promise of the resurrection has not lost His power to take even the worst tragedy and bring it into the light of His love and power.
